Favorites are not project specific.

 

Your preference seems very reasonable - I had to test it because I thought it might be as you expected.

 

But Media Browser is a Panel by itself, and each project has its own Project Panel. So I think Favorites in Media Browser can only be specific to the PR version you are using.

 

If I open PR 2023 and, in Project One, I set Folder A as a favorite, it shows. I close Project One, Create Project Two, and set the favorite in Media Browser to be Folder B. When I close Project Two and reopen Project One, the favorite is Folder B.

 

If I close PR 2023 and open PR 2022, all my projects there have whatever Favorite I set last in PR 2022.
